<p>Wondering what the most watched show on subscription streaming is? According to NBC it&#8217;s <em>The Office</em>, and as such, it&#8217;s no surprise that once the company&#8217;s <a href="https://www.engadget.com/2010/09/24/netflix-nbc-universal-content-deal-brings-battlestar-galactica/">agreement with Netflix</a> <a href="https://www.engadget.com/2019/01/14/nbcuniversal-free-tv-streaming-service-2020/">expires at the end of 2020</a>, <a href="http://www.nbcuniversal.com/press-release/%E2%80%9C-office%E2%80%9D-returns-nbcuniversal-2021">it&#8217;s keeping the show for its own streaming service</a>. The ad-supported NBCUniversal package is launching in 2020, but it won&#8217;t have the show&#8217;s nine seasons until 2021.</p>
<p>It&#8217;s following a trend we&#8217;ve seen from <a href="https://www.engadget.com/2019/05/14/att-to-pull-tv-shows-from-streaming-rivals/">AT&amp;T</a> and <a href="https://www.engadget.com/2019/04/11/disney-plus/">Disney</a>, as they try to capitalize on back catalogs to launch new streaming competitors. Of course, for viewers it means they won&#8217;t be able to see popular shows all in one place, and it&#8217;s unclear how this will impact international distribution. In response, Netflix <a href="https://twitter.com/netflix/status/1143643776637792257">tweeted</a> that at least members can binge watch &#8220;ad-free&#8221; until January 2021.</p>
